Household of Johannes Wilhelmus Basoski

He is married to Johanna Maria van der Hoeven.

They got married on June 22, 1904 at Rotterdam, he was 23 years old.Source 1

Gebeurtenis:Huwelijk Datum:woensdag 22 juni 1904
Gebeurtenisplaats:Rotterdam
Bruidegom:Johannes Wilhelmus Basoski
Geboorteplaats:Rotterdam Leeftijd:23
Bruid:Johanna Maria van der Hoeven
Geboorteplaats:Rotterdam Leeftijd:27
Vader bruidegom:Gerrit Johannes Basoski
Moeder bruidegom:Maria Catharina Bouwens
Vader bruid:Cornelis van der Hoeven
Moeder bruid:Christina Spolet
Plaats instelling:Rotterdam Collectiegebied:Zuid-Holland
Pagina:g20v Registratiedatum:1904 Akteplaats:Rotterdam
